We report the growth and characterization of improved efficiency wide-bandgap ZnO/CdS/CuGaSe2 thin-film solar cells. The CuGaSe2 absorber thickness was intentionally decreased to better match depletion widths indicated by drive-level capacitance profiling data. A total-area efficiency of 9.5% was achieved with a fill factor of 70.8% and a V-oc of 910 mV. Published in 2003 by John Wiley Sons, Ltd.
